At Mathnasium of Coconut Grove, our specially trained tutors use the Mathnasium Method™ to help students build a deep understanding of math. This proprietary teaching approach blends personalized learning plans with mental, verbal, visual, tactile, and written techniques, ensuring instruction is tailored to each student’s unique needs and learning style.
The Mathnasium Method™ is designed to create a solid foundation for math excellence, helping students truly understand—and even enjoy—math.
Our caring, specially trained math tutors in Miami provide face-to-face instruction in a supportive and engaging group environment. We work with K-12 students of all skill levels, both in-center and online, to help them reach their full math potential.

We support students in grades K–12 across a wide range of math topics, from early arithmetic and number sense to Algebra 1/Algebra 2, Geometry and Precalculus. We also offer test preparation for exams like the ACT® and SAT®.
With support from our specially trained tutors, students strengthen their math skills and gain the tools they need to perform well in the classroom and on standardized tests.
We offer math-only tutoring through a flat monthly membership fee with no long-term contracts. While most students benefit from attending 2–3 sessions per week, a free assessment helps us determine the ideal program for your child.

Each student begins with a diagnostic assessment designed to identify their current understanding of key concepts, highlight learning gaps, and define academic goals. This assessment informs a personalized learning plan that supports lasting improvement.
At Mathnasium of Coconut Grove, we don’t use a fixed curriculum. We follow the Mathnasium Method™, our proprietary teaching approach that blends personalized learning plans with proven instructional strategies.
This approach helps students make sense of math by breaking down complex topics into manageable steps. We focus on closing knowledge gaps and building strong foundations for math mastery while strengthening problem-solving skills, critical thinking, and confidence.
